As nouns, bifurcation is a hyponym of ramification; that is, bifurcation is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than ramification:
  • ramification: the act of branching out or dividing into branches
  • bifurcation: the act of splitting into two branches
Other hyponyms of ramification include trifurcation, divarication, fibrillation.
As nouns, bifurcation is a hyponym of ramification; that is, bifurcation is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than ramification:
  • ramification: a part of a forked or branching shape
  • bifurcation: a bifurcating branch (one or both of them)
Other hyponyms of ramification include brachium, crotch, fork.
